Grade 3: Route includes rough surfaces that may include small boulders, potholes, shallow ruts, loose gravel, short muddy sections.
Access grade X: At least one stile, flight of steps or other obstacle that is highly likely to block access for wheelchair and scooter users.

I walked this route from Bingham in September. There is a route-finding problem at the Bingham end because of building work, Having left the market place and crossed the railway, the section between SK70454.40454 and the A46 has been diverted, but is not well signed. The path NNW no longer exists. Go round the pond on a good path and cross Car Dyke on a footbridge (SK70704.40772) to pick up the right-of-way which takes you to the roundabout on the old A46 near Burrowfields farm, via High Westing farm. After that, route-finding is easy. A mixture of quiet roads/lanes, farm-tracks and footpaths. Very enjoyable. Refreshments are available in East Bridgford, Gunthorpe and Thurgarton.
